Abstract
The relevant parameters in the ant colony algorithm have great impact on algorithm performance and various parameters are closely linked, and a good parameter combination will increase the overall search capability and convergence of algorithm. At present, the parameter settings of the ant colony algorithm are determined relying on experience and experiments which have heavy workload and it is difficult to get the optimal combination of parameters. On the basis of the idea that algorithm parameters are uniformly designed, a combination of representative experimental points (parameter values) is selected for experimental design, and a satisfactory combination of algorithm parameters is found with fewer number of experiments, so that the optimum operating performance can be realized by the algorithm. The simulation experiments show that the method is feasible and effective.
